CVE-2025-38461 affecting package kernel for versions less than 6.6.104.2-1
Details

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

vsock: Fix transport_* TOCTOU

Transport assignment may race with module unload. Protect new_transport from becoming a stale pointer.

This also takes care of an insecure call in vsockuselocal_transport(); add a lockdep assert.

BUG: unable to handle page fault for address: fffffbfff8056000 Oops: Oops: 0000 [#1] SMP KASAN RIP: 0010:vsockassigntransport+0x366/0x600 Call Trace: vsock_connect+0x59c/0xc40 __sys_connect+0xe8/0x100 __x64sysconnect+0x6e/0xc0 dosyscall64+0x92/0x1c0 entrySYSCALL64afterhwframe+0x4b/0x53
